  1. 1 Whether the marriage between the parties has broken down beyond reconciliation

Ratio Decidendi

The marriage has broken down beyond reconciliation as evidenced by the parties living apart for over a year, failed reconciliation attempts, and the payment of alimony, with no contest from the respondent.

Court Disposition

petition granted; marriage dissolved

Orders

  • The marriage celebrated between the parties on 9th December 2017 at the Presbyterian Church of Ghana, Redemption Congregation, Kokomlemle North, Accra is hereby dissolved.
  • No order as to cost.
